TheAVP TPA & Payor Solutions Technology position will be responsible for the technology strategy and delivery for our Aetnas TPA and Payor business including Meritain American Health Holding First Health and Aetna Signature Administrators. This role will report directly to theVP of Aetna DDAT Commercial Network and Provider.

As a senior leader you will work collaboratively across business and technology teams to develop strategies that transform disrupt and enable our business. You will dive deep into the technical and business details of this domain ensuring a focused strategy and delivery. This is a technical leadership role

Primary Job Responsibilities:

  • Operational Leadership: Lead the organization endtoend ensuring alignment between business and technology and delivering on shared outcomes.
  • Business Partnership: Develop businessaligned technology strategies focused on disrupting and transforming the portfolio.
  • Strategic Development: Create a North Star strategy for the portfolio and align people process and technology into an executable framework.
  • People Management: Strategically manage a staff of 350 resources while maintaining target ratios to achieve enterprise goals.
  • Program/Project Delivery: Manage a portfolio of investments in the $2040M range ensuring projects are executed on time on budget and with quality.
  • Industry Awareness: Stay updated on industry advancements new business models and prepare technology systems accordingly.
  • Operational Efficiencies: Optimize efficiencies through augmentation and automation brought by DevSecOps increased test automation simplified architectural designs AI etc
  • System Stability: Ensure stability of over 100 applications manage production incidents analyze and resolve root causes and improve code and test quality towards a zeroincident target state.
  • Innovation and Delivery: Partner with third parties to maximize innovation and delivery.
  • Business Case Development: Develop business cases to drive innovation and disruption.
  • Product model: Drive the project to product transformation ensuring we are constantly evolving our services.

Required Qualifications:

  • 15 years of experience in technology leadership and delivery with a track record of building and growing teams.
  • 5 years of experience in healthcare focusing on network provider and claim systems with an understanding of both payor and provider perspectives.
  • Deep experience leading largescale globally distributed teams and ensuring the health and stability of production operations.
  • Experience in financial management of large corporate portfolios and cost center expenses.
  • Technical expertise in triaging understanding and solving complex challenges across various technology stacks enterprise integrations and vendor platforms.
  • Familiarity with various delivery methodologies including Scaled Agile (SAFE) Scrum Agile and hybrid Agile/Waterfall models.
  • Experience in technology delivery within highly regulated sectors such as healthcare or financial industries.
  • Excellent communication and presentation skills with the ability to distill complex topics into understandable information.
  • Ability to engage deeply with technology teams and explain complex problems and solutions to business partners and senior leaders.
  • Proven ability to establish and sustain professional relationships through close business partnerships.
  • Provide mentorship coaching and development to immediate leadership and extended teams.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Experience leading digital enablement and transformative initiatives.
  • Experience optimizing and enhancing legacy systems with newer technology or practices.

Education:

  • Bachelors Degree

Pay Range

The typical pay range for this role is:

$185400.00 $375950.00


This pay range represents the base hourly rate or base annual fulltime salary for all positions in the job grade within which this position falls. The actual base salary offer will depend on a variety of factors including experience education geography and other relevant factors. This position is eligible for a CVS Health bonus commission or shortterm incentive program in addition to the base pay range listed above. This position also includes an award target in the companys equity award program.
